How is the weather in Oxford?
Oxford has mild winters around 29–53°F (-2–12°C), with summer temperatures reaching 86–89°F (30–32°C). Spring and fall bring comfortable days and are known for frequent rainfall.
What are the best places to visit in Oxford?
Popular stops include the historic Oxford Square, Rowan Oak, and the University of Mississippi Museum. The Gertrude C. Ford Center for the Performing Arts is also known for music, theater, and cultural programs.
What are some hiking trails in Oxford?
Explore the South Campus Rail Trail, trails at Lamar Park, or wooded paths near the Whirlpool Trails area. These locations have walking, jogging, and birdwatching opportunities in natural surroundings.

What is Oxford known for?
Oxford is recognized for its literary heritage, historic Oxford Square, and vibrant arts and music scene. The city also has university sports, unique eateries, and sites connected to Southern history and culture.

What are the best foods to try in Oxford?
Oxford has locally rooted Southern cuisine, frequently suggested dishes include catfish, barbecue, and homemade pies. Regional twists on breakfast classics and diverse dining options are found near the Square.

What are the most popular events or festivals in Oxford?
The Double Decker Arts Festival in late spring is often recommended for music, art, and food. University football weekends and the Oxford Film Festival draw visitors, while seasonal celebrations fill the calendar.
